The Government intends to solicit an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) with a basic period of performance of one (1) base year (one (1) calendar year) with two(2) 6-month option periods for Airfield Contruction and Repair functions at Joint Base Balad, Iraq. The contractor shall provide all plant, labor, supervision, equipment, materials, transportation, and perform all operations necessary to provide airfield construction and repair functions to include, but not limited to, rubber removal, concrete slab replacement, reseal pavement joint(s), partial depth spall repair, full depth spall repair, crack sealing, joint sealing, and airfield marking/striping. The applicable North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) for this acquisition is 237310. Basis of award will be Performance Price Tradeoff (PPT) with technical evaluation factors. A competitive best value source selection will be conducted in which the competing offerors' past performance history, and response to the Technical Evaluation criteria, when combined, will be evaluated on a basis significantly more important than cost/price considerations. The resultant award will be a firm fixed price construction contract. The Government reserves the right to award a contract to other than the low offeror if the offer is judged to provide the overall best value to the Government. All eligible and responsible sources may submit a proposal which shall be considered by the agency. The estimated magnitude of this project, to include all option periods, is between $1,000,000 and $5,000,000.
